红桃视频深度体验报告:缓存机制、加载速度等技术层体验报告(2025 深度修订版)

摘要 本报告以红桃视频为核心案例,系统梳理了其在缓存机制、加载速度与渲染路径等技术层面的表现与演化。通过对比常见的缓存策略、CDN与边缘缓存的作用、以及流式传输、资源分发和前端优化手段,提供一份面向开发与运维的落地评估。文中所述测试方法与结果以公开可复现的指标为基准,聚焦用户实际体验的感知速度与稳定性,并给出可执行的改进路径,帮助团队在2025年保持高可用与高性能。
一、研究背景与目标 随着视频内容日益丰富、用户期望值提升,页面加载时间、资源获取效率与稳定的播放体验成为关键竞争点。缓存机制直接影响首屏呈现速度、二次请求延时、以及视频流的起播时间;加载速度则直接决定用户在不同网络条件下的可用性与留存率。本报告围绕红桃视频的核心页面(信息页、列表页、以及视频播放页)展开,试图揭示缓存策略的实际效果、前端渲染的瓶颈及改进方向,助力开发在保证体验的同时降低成本、提升可维护性。
二、缓存机制深入分析 1) 浏览器端缓存策略
- Cache-Control、Expires、ETag/LAS机制的合理配置能显著降低重复请求。对静态资源(JS、CSS、图片、字体)设置长期缓存,并结合版本化命名(如 hash 命名)实现缓存命中。
- 使用短期的缓存失效策略结合强制重新验证,可在内容更新时快速同步,同时保留旧一定时间的命中率。
- 对动态内容和用户相关数据,避免直接缓存或采用边缘缓存中的自定义策略,确保数据的新鲜性与一致性。
- Vary、Depending on Accept-Encoding 等头部要素需谨慎设置,避免错误的缓存命中导致内容错配。
2) 服务端与应用层缓存
- 应用层缓存(如热点数据、视频元数据、热门榜单)通过分布式缓存实现高频访问的快速读取,降低数据库压力。
- 对于相关推荐、分页数据等具有时效性但热度稳定的数据,设定合理的过期策略与刷新机制,避免缓存穿透与雪崩效应。
- 针对用户个性化数据,开启分区缓存或使用短生命周期策略,确保个性化体验的同时维持稳定性。
3) CDN 与边缘缓存
- 将静态资源和常用动态资源推送到就近边缘节点,降低请求跨地域传输时延,提升首屏渲染速度。
- 通过缓存命中率监控与分发策略优化,确保热点资源在高并发场景下仍然具备低延时访问。
- 版本化资源、边缘无状态计算和服务器端渲染(在可能情况下)结合,提升边缘端的可用性和一致性。
4) 资源分包与版本控制
- 将视频相关的前端资源分包,按用途和更新频率分档缓存,降低单次更新对全站缓存的影响。
- 使用资源指纹(如哈希值)对静态资源进行版本化,避免旧资源被错误缓存导致的加载问题。
- 对视频播放器及其依赖(如广告脚本、统计脚本)进行独立缓存策略,以避免重复获取与无效更新。
5) 渲染层缓存与预取策略
- 页面级快照缓存、SSR(服务端渲染)缓存、以及客户端的缓存策略协同,能显著缩短首屏时间。
- 通过 preconnect、dns-prefetch、preload、prefetch 等资源提示,降低资源请求的初始延迟,提升用户在点击后到可交互的速度。
- 视频播放相关初始资源应尽量早期加载,确保用户点击后能在可接受的时间内看到播放器并进入缓冲阶段。
三、加载速度与渲染路径的技术要点 1) 渐进式加载与流式传输
- 对视频资源,ABR(自适应比特率流)通过分段传输实现平滑的起播与切换,减少起播等待时间和缓冲跳变。
- 使用高效编解码格式(如 AV1)与现代容器,降低带宽占用并提升同等带宽条件下的画质体验。
- 务必确保播放器前端尽早建立网络连接、建立TLS握手并尽早开始初始请求,以缩短初次渲染周期。
2) 渲染路径中的关键指标
- TTFB(首字节时间)、FCP(首次内容绘制)、LCP(最大内容绘制)、CLS(布局偏移稳定性)、TTI(交互准备时间)等在视频站点的不同场景下的权衡至关重要。
- 良好的缓存策略通常提升 FCP/LCP 的稳定性,降低 CLS 的波动,提升用户对页面就绪的主观感知。
- 通过监控 INP(交互准备时间)与 Speed Index,可以更细致地评估播放器界面的响应性。
3) 网络与传输协议
- 采用 HTTP/3(基于 QUIC)的传输,能在不稳定网络条件下减少握手与重传带来的额外延时。
- TLS 1.3 的使用不仅提升安全性,也对握手延迟有积极贡献。
- CDN 的就近分发与边缘缓存的协同,允许在网络高峰期维持稳定的起播与滑动加载体验。
4) 视频资源的优化要点
- 将视频分段长度、缓冲策略、起播阈值等参数进行精细调优,确保不同网络条件下都能快速进入缓冲与播放阶段。
- 对于首屏相关的前置资源(如播放器皮肤、脚本、广告投放脚本)采用优先级控制与并发请求管理,避免阻塞主渲染线程。
- 使用现代视频编码与容器格式,并对浏览器兼容性做兼容性处理,最大化覆盖率与性能收益。
四、测试方法与实验环境 1) 测试工具与指标
- Lighthouse、WebPageTest、Chrome DevTools 的网络与性能面板,以及实时监测工具,用于获取 TTFB、FCP、LCP、CLS、TTI、Speed Index、First CPU Idle 等指标。
- 真实用户指标(RUM)与合成测试结合,确保理论性能与真实场景的吻合。
2) 场景设置
- 网络条件:4G、5G、宽带、以及不稳定网络场景下的对比,覆盖典型用户环境。
- 设备分辨率与浏览器组合:从移动端到桌面端的多样化设备,以评估跨端体验的一致性。
- 测试用例:信息页加载、列表页瀚览、视频详情页、视频起播与初始缓冲阶段、以及广告投放场景下的加载表现。
3) 实验流程
- 基线测试:在未对缓存进行优化的情况下获取初始指标。
- 缓存与网络优化组合测试:依次启用浏览器缓存、CDN 边缘缓存、资源分包、预取/预加载等手段,记录各阶段指标变化。
- 视频起播与切换测试:评估 ABR、缓冲策略对起播时间与节拍稳定性的影响。
- 结果对比与统计:对比不同场景下的关键指标,绘制可视化对照表,标注主要改善点。
五、关键指标、结果与解读 1) 缓存对起播的影响
- 浏览器缓存、CDN 命中及资源指纹化策略在静态资源层面的命中率提升显著,导致初次加载时的网络请求数下降、TTFB 降低,FCP/LCP 提前实现。
- 对视频播放器依赖脚本的缓存管理,减少了重复下载与解析耗时,提升了首次可交互时间。
2) 渲染路径优化的效果
- 启用 preconnect/preload 策略后,渲染路径的前置延时明显下降,尤其在网络条件不佳的场景中,用户感知的首屏就绪时间有明显改善。
- 使用边缘缓存配合 ABR 流式传输,起播时间在多数场景下降低到可接受区间,缓冲跳动更少。
3) 流式传输与编解码选择
- 采用高效编解码与分段传输,降低带宽峰值,提升在不稳定网络中的起播可用性。
- ABR 切换的平滑性与画质波动控制,直接关系到用户的观看连续性与留存。
4) 总体结论
- 综合来看,缓存机制的正确配置与边缘分发的有效协同,是提升加载速度与稳定性的关键。
- 渲染路径的优化、资源分包与预取策略、以及对视频传输的精细调控,共同构成了可观的体验提升。
- 2025 年前后,随着 HTTP/3、边缘计算、以及更高效视频编解码的普及,继续在网络层与前端架构层面进行协同优化,能持续推动体验的显著提升。
六、优化建议与实施路径 1) 服务端与缓存策略

- 对静态资源实行长期缓存(含版本化命名),对动态数据采用短期或按需失效策略,确保数据新鲜性与缓存命中率。
- 加强边缘缓存策略,在高并发场景下优先命中就近节点,降低跨区域传输延迟。
- 针对热销内容和高访问量的页面,建立快速刷新机制,避免缓存穿透与缓存击穿。
2) 前端与资源管理
- 启用 preconnect、dns-prefetch、preload,优先为关键资源建立连接并提前加载。
- 将播放器及核心依赖脚本以模块化、异步加载方式组织,缩短阻塞渲染的时间。
- 对视频相关资源采取分段化加载,尽量在用户交互前就完成必要的初始化数据获取。
3) 视频传输与编解码
- 优化 ABR 逻辑,确保在各种网络条件下的平滑切换,降低卡顿与画质波动。
- 优先考虑高效编解码格式与容器,结合设备端能力动态选择编码参数,提升同等带宽下的画质与流畅性。
4) 监控与持续改进
- 建立持续的 RUM 与 SLI/SLO 指标体系,结合日常发布流程进行性能回归。
- 针对不同地区、不同设备的用户行为进行分层分析,识别瓶颈区域并定向优化。
- 将缓存命中率、起播时间、缓冲时长等关键指标纳入变更评估,确保改动带来正向收益。
七、2025 深度修订点
- HTTP/3 与 QUIC 的全面落地:进一步降低握手与重传成本,在全球分发场景下提升跨区域加载速度与稳定性。
- 边缘计算与分布式缓存的协同:通过更密集的边缘节点与智能路由,减少跨区域请求与时延,提升首屏与起播的一致性。
- 流媒体传输的进一步优化:在不同终端上实现更高效的自适应码率策略,减少大屏端的峰值带宽开销,同时保留流畅的观看体验。
- 浏览器端进化:新兴浏览器特性与资源调度优化将为资源加载带来更精细的控制,进一步缩短关键渲染路径。
- 数据隐私与合规性:在提升性能的同时,强化对用户数据的保护与合规审查,建立透明的性能与数据处理政策。
八、结论 通过对红桃视频在缓存机制、加载速度和技术层体验的深度分析,可以看出,缓存策略与边缘分发、渲染路径优化以及视频传输的协同,是提升用户体验的核心驱动。在2025年的技术演进中,HTTP/3、边缘计算、分布式缓存和高效编解码将持续推动车站点性能的提升。若将以上建议落地实施,既能提升首屏与起播的速度,也能在高并发、跨地域场景下保持稳定的用户体验,为品牌形象和用户留存带来长期收益。
参考与延展
- 浏览器缓存与资源版本化的最佳实践(行业公开文档与厂商指南)
- CDN 与边缘缓存的设计与运维要点
- Web Performance 指标体系(Lighthouse、WebPageTest、RUM 指标)
- 流式传输与自适应码率(HLS/DASH、ABR 策略的设计要点)
- HTTP/3、QUIC、TLS 1.3 的性能与安全性影响
若你希望,我可以把这篇稿件分成适合上传到你 Google 网站的分段版本,或者按你的站点结构(如博客、案例研究、技术白皮书等)做成对应的页面布局与导航结构,确保发布时的可读性与可维护性。